I doubt any other conference in America has a stat as wacky as this: one of the conference's historically-weakest programs (Ohio) has had coaches with the second and third most wins in conference history.

It helps that the all-time great coaches at Miami, Toledo and Bowling Green, moved up to bigger jobs so quickly (and Marshall moved out of the conference when Bob Pruett was steamrolling towards the top), but it's still funny to think that Ohio has two of the top three when Urban Meyer, Nick Saban, Ara Parseghian, and Bo Schembechler were head coaches in the conference.

Also, it seems like Gary Pinkel should've gotten into the top three given how long he was at Toledo, how good Toledo is as a program and how good of a coach he is.

Here is how Ohio stacks up in the MAC in all-time winning % and where they rank compared to the 128 teams currently in FBS-

#26. Miami .600(673-441-44)
#27. CMU .598(603-399-36)
#33. BGSU .589(533-364-52)
#54. Toledo .554(518-414-24)
#55. WMU .552(545-440-24)
#63. NIU .538(532-455-38)
#70. Ball St .521(439-402-32)
#80. Ohio .500(546-546-48)
#90. Akron .491(506-526-36)
#111. EMU .438(442-575-47)
#120. Kent St .389(336-535-28)
#124. Buffalo .365(103-181-4)

Ohio has a losing record against seven of the 11 current MAC members. It hasn't won a MAC championship since 1968. It hasn't produced a first-round draft pick since 1936. For one moribund period, it was the worst program in Division I. We stormed the field once because we beat the Akron Zips.

I feel more than justified in using the term historically-weak in the MAC.
